  • Before distinguishing natural and lab grown diamonds, learn the distinctions.
  • Over billions of years, Earth's mantle pressure and temperature created natural diamonds.
  •  lab grown diamonds are created using HPHT and CVD in controlled settings. Their chemical makeup and crystal structure match diamonds.
  • Remember lab grown diamonds are real. This diamond is manmade.

How to identify lab grown diamond?

Check Certification

 A diamond's natural or lab grown status can best be determined by certification from respected gemological bodies like.

  • American Gemological Institute
  • International Gemological Institute
  • Antwerp HRD
  • The certificate states whether the diamond is natural or lab grown.

 

Flaws and Inclusions

 Diamonds containing tiny minerals, growth marks, or other imperfections from billions of years are natural.

  •  lab grown diamonds often have metallic inclusions or striations.
  • A skilled gemologist can detect these alterations under a microscope.

 

Fluorescence/growth patterns

  Advanced UV light testing shows development patterns.

  • CVD lab diamond cross-hatches.
  • HPHT diamonds may include metallic flux.
  • Diamond growth is irregular in nature.

 

Spectroscopy

 Gemologists use photoluminescence and infrared spectroscopy to identify diamonds. This method is accurate, but it cannot be tested at home.

 

Type Classification Test

 The majority of natural diamonds are Type Ia, while lab grown are IIa or Ib. Categorisation can be determined with sophisticated technology, like a DiamondView machine.

 

UV test

 UV light exposure:

  • Lab diamonds shine brighter and more evenly.
  • Natural diamonds sparkle unevenly or not.
  • This test suggests but cannot prove without professional opinion.

 

  1. Inscription Laser

 The girdle of many lab grown diamonds is laser-inscribed " lab grown" or "LGD". A jeweler's loupe magnifies this.

Diamond: Real or lab grown?

Remember lab grown diamonds exist. They are not “fakes” like cubic zirconia or moissanite. Natural and lab grown diamonds have the same Mohs hardness (10) and optical brilliance.

 “Is my diamond real or lab?” is valid. lab grown diamonds are real but man-made. Expert certification is needed to validate its origin.
